Demand for infant rations surges

  Due to the unexpected severity of the epidemic, the inventory of many residents' homes is tight, and the most concerned is the "ration" of infants and young children - infant formula milk powder.

According to statistics from Wyeth Nutritional Products, from April 1st to 10th, its 400 service hotline and online public account received as many as 7,775 inquiries on consumer milk powder demand.

  The relevant person in charge of Wyeth Nutritional Products Co., Ltd. stated that, as a guaranteed supply enterprise recognized by the Shanghai Municipal Commission of Commerce, Wyeth Nutritional Products promised 48 hours of “door-to-door delivery” during the epidemic. With the support, the company obtained the livelihood guarantee letter and vehicle pass to ensure transportation to overcome the impact of the transportation capacity during the epidemic; on the other hand, the logistics staff of Wyeth Nutrition Company also rushed for time on the "last mile" of the service.

  Every morning at 9:00, Chen Jun, a Wyeth logistics security staff member, starts a day's delivery work. In order to bring more milk powder, Chen Jun has always set out alone. At this time, his private car went from the co-pilot to the trunk. It has been stuffed with more than 30 boxes of milk powder.

  In order to ensure the safety of delivery, Chen Jun must wear an isolation suit and be fully armed. In recent days, the temperature in Shanghai at noon has exceeded 30 degrees. When the goods are loaded, transported and delivered in one day, Chen Jun is all wet. He even said with a smile "I don't have to go to the bathroom all day, it just evaporates."

  The delivery work itself is not easy. Since infant formula milk powder is a special food, every time Chen Jun delivers to a community, he needs to carry out secondary disinfection and contact the volunteers in the community for separate delivery. It also takes more time per delivery.

  Often Chen Jun returned to the warehouse at 2 am after delivering the goods every day, and Chen Jun could not rest immediately. He had to sort out the goods to be used the next day, conduct antigen tests, and submit the test results online.

After all, Chen Jun can only rest for 4-5 hours a day, but in his view, in the current situation of tight transportation, ensuring the safety of infants and young children's rations is an unshirkable responsibility.

  A reporter from China Business News learned that there are not a few milk powder people running on the streets of Shanghai to ensure supply. Due to the large demand for milk powder, dairy companies are trying their best to ensure the demand of citizens for infant formula milk powder.

  Danone, which is also a supply guarantee company in Shanghai, on the one hand, through its official milk powder service platform "Feed Free", helps citizens to find the daily updated offline supply stores and organizes direct purchases in the community; on the other hand, in order to ensure transportation capacity , Danone cooperated with Dada Express and Fosun Commercial Stream, the latter squeezed out 30 and 10 trucks to send directly to the community every day under the tight transportation capacity, which can cover the milk powder demand of 500-600 community families every day.

  However, during the visit, a number of interviewed milk powder managers said that due to the epidemic lockdown, many vehicles and drivers were also affected. Therefore, how to ensure transportation capacity is also the biggest difficulty in ensuring the supply of milk powder this time. "Qianli" for milk

  In addition to infant formula milk powder, in the epidemic, dairy products are a daily necessity for citizens, and the pressure to ensure the supply is also huge.

  As a local dairy company in Shanghai, Bright Dairy started a closed management approach in the early days of the fight against the epidemic to ensure the production and supply of local milk.

In response to the shortage of milk delivery staff and other insufficient distribution capabilities brought about by the epidemic prevention and control, Bright Dairy has dispatched functional personnel from headquarters operations, finance, marketing, legal affairs and other departments to serve as volunteers to ensure the normal operation of the milk station.

  Recently, in order to allow more citizens to drink milk, Bright Dairy has integrated all its factory resources, urgently allocated national products, and opened a special railway train to deliver milk to Shanghai.

On April 11 alone, Bright Dairy's Heilongjiang and Tianjin factories shipped 1,526 tons and 1,300 tons of milk. After that, milk from Bright's Zhengzhou and other factories will also arrive in Shanghai to ensure supply.

  According to Han Chaodong of Heilongjiang Guangming Songhe Factory, after receiving the task of guaranteeing supply, the factory set up a party member commando team, temporarily dispatched 32 employees, and completed the loading of 1,526 tons of milk in 56 carriages in 30 hours. At present, the factory is still working overtime. production, to ensure that another 1,500 tons of milk will be shipped to Shanghai on the 13th.

  In addition to Bright Dairy, Mengniu Dairy also sends more than 100 tons of fresh milk from the Ma'anshan factory every day. After a journey of nearly 400 kilometers, it joins the work of ensuring the supply of dairy products in Shanghai.

  A reporter from China Business News learned that compared with milk powder, fresh milk needs to be delivered daily, and it is more difficult and pressured to ensure supply.

  According to Zheng Lei, general manager of Mengniu's fresh milk business "Tianxian Pian", after the closure, the demand for fresh milk from citizens increased significantly, and more than 5,000 fresh milk were delivered every day. The employees of "Tian Xian Pian" have become milk workers. They arrive at the cold storage to pick up milk and load trucks at 7 o'clock in the morning. On average, each person has to deliver more than 100 servings of milk every day, and they can not return to the hotel until about 11 o'clock in the evening.

  Due to the closure of the epidemic, the catering business was suspended, and the milk delivery staff could only change three meals a day to two in the morning and evening; they wore protective clothing to deliver 200 kilograms of fresh milk every day, and the work intensity was very high; and because fresh milk could not be left in the car overnight , In order to raise milk early in the morning, many employees simply live in the car; these days, some employees lose 15 pounds in 7 days, and some have a flat tire in their private car.
